Each day, a small ritual of language unfolds for thousands of players who sit down with Hurdle — a word puzzle that does not simply reset but builds, each solved word becoming the foundation for the next. On August 12, five words — NYMPH, SCOUT, TAINT, EMAIL, and SHREW — formed a chain of meaning, asking players to move from mythology to nature, from contamination to communication, in a single sitting. These daily games, modest as they appear, speak to something enduring in human nature: the desire to find pattern in chaos, and the quiet satisfaction of a mind clicking into place.
